Greater Shepparton City Council will soon construct a new roundabout at the intersection of Orrvale Road and Poplar Avenue in Shepparton, thanks to funding secured through the Federal Government’s Black Spot Program.
Construction is planned to commence on Wednesday 4 September 2024.
To facilitate the safe construction of the new roundabout, the intersection will be closed for approximately nine weeks, weather permitting.
Due to the full closure of this busy intersection, the community is encouraged to plan alternate travel routes during the construction timeframe. Signed detours will be in place to direct motorists, with Channel Road available throughout the construction period.
